AI Summary

  • Urges United States Congress to remove wood bison from protection under the Endangered Species Act of 1973 and transfer control of wood bison management in Alaska to the state.

  • States that Alaska intends to reintroduce approximately 100 wood bison to provide hunting opportunities in rural areas, which is constrained by the current endangered species designation.

  • Argues that wood bison protected under the Endangered Species Act pose risks to resource development, citing the Donlin Creek mine valued at $70 billion that could be jeopardized if bison wander into the area.

  • References Canada's declaration under the Species at Risk Act that the proposed wood bison for Alaska are surplus and their loss would not negatively affect Canadian wood bison restoration.

  • Notes that Alaska's Department of Fish and Game has successfully managed genetically similar plains bison for over 70 years and is capable of managing wood bison under state control.
